在中国传统文化中,对联是一种独特的艺术形式,它以韵文的形式表达出作者的思想感情和生活观察,对联通常出现在春节、婚礼等重要场合,用以装点环境,增添节日气氛,对于非专业人士来说,制作一副对联可能需要花费大量的时间和精力,幸运的是,随着计算机技术的发展,我们现在可以使用Python来轻松地制作对联,本文将详细介绍如何使用Python绘制长方形对联。
我们需要安装Python的绘图库matplotlib,matplotlib是一个用于创建静态、动态、交互式图表的Python库,我们可以使用pip命令来安装matplotlib:
pip install matplotlib
安装完成后,我们就可以开始编写代码了,我们需要导入matplotlib库,并设置一些基本的绘图参数:
import matplotlib.pyplot as plt plt.figure(figsize=(8, 6)) plt.title('长方形对联') plt.xlabel('横轴') plt.ylabel('纵轴')
接下来,我们需要定义对联的内容,在这里,我们假设对联的内容已经由用户输入:
content1 = input('请输入上联内容:') content2 = input('请输入下联内容:')
我们需要计算对联的位置,在这里,我们假设对联的宽度为0.3,高度为0.15:
x1 = 0.15 y1 = 0.85 x2 = 0.85 y2 = 0.85
我们可以使用plt.text函数来在指定位置添加对联的内容:
plt.text(x1, y1, content1, fontsize=12) plt.text(x2, y2, content2, fontsize=12)
至此,我们已经完成了长方形对联的绘制,我们可以使用plt.show函数来显示对联:
plt.show()
以上就是使用Python绘制长方形对联的全过程,通过这个例子,我们可以看到,Python不仅可以用于复杂的数据分析和机器学习任务,也可以用于这种简单的图像处理任务,无论你是编程初学者,还是有一定编程基础的人,都可以尝试使用Python来制作自己的对联,希望这篇文章能够帮助你更好地理解和使用Python。
还没有评论,来说两句吧...